👥 Demographics & Identity in Lucinda
Who lives here — how many people, how old they are, and how communities identify.
A typical resident in Lucinda is now 60 years old, making the area far older than most other places in the region. This aging trend is a defining feature of the community, where the population has grown by 63% since 2011 to reach 431 people.

Age profile
How the population splits across age groups.
Seniors aged 65 and over make up 39.4% of the population, far above the Queensland figure of 17%. This shift is linked to a sharp drop in children under 15, who now make up only 12.1% of residents.

Identity & relationships
First Nations identity and marital status.
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people make up 5.1% of the population, which is about the same as the state average. Over half of the residents are married, and 12.1% are in de facto relationships.
